External ATF Cooler Kit Installation
1. Disconnect negative battery cable.2. Remove left side splash shield.
3. Remove front bumper cover and bumper according to Workshop Manual (section 09-10-5).
NOTE:
It is necessary to remove the bumper to gain access to the bracket installation hole according to: STEP 3 of the Oil Pipe Bracket Installation procedure in this bulletin.
4. Remove plastic seal plate at the left side of the bumper and replace with modified part from External ATF Cooler kit.
5. Drain engine coolant and remove radiator according to Workshop Manual (section 01-12-4).
CAUTION:
Radiator MUST be replaced with modified part from External ATF Cooler kit. Failure to replace radiator may result in transmission failure.
6. Temporarily install oil cooler into position at left front of vehicle.
7. Align mounting tabs on left side of cooler with existing mounting holes located on cross member center support for hood latch.
8. Install two(2) 6x25 mm bolts and temporarily tighten.
9. Using a center punch, make a mark at the center of the two remaining mounting tab holes.
10. Remove two(2) 6x25 mm bolts (installed in STEP 8) and oil cooler.
11. Using a 7 mm (9/32") drill bit, drill 2 holes in the mounting locations marked in STEP 9.
12. To prevent rust, apply a small amount of silicone or anti corrosion to the holes.
13. Reinstall oil cooler.
14. Install lower right mounting bolt using backing nut with L shaped bracket by inserting the nut through the slot to the right of the mounting hole
15. Install upper right mounting bolt using one of the 6 mm flange nuts.
NOTE:
On 2000-01 model year vehicles, install the left side mounting tab to the center stay using a 25 mm bolt.
On 1998-99 model year vehicles, do not install the left side mounting bolt at this time. A longer 35 mm bolt will be installed with the bumper cover in a later step.
16. Proceed to Oil Pipe Bracket Installation procedure.
